Anyone new to project management will appreciate this foundation course. Also ideal for project team members, operational staff and general team leaders, this takes you through the essentials of successful project management.


How will this benefit me?

You will learn about the project management life cycle, as well as common project management terminology and concepts. In a group learning environment, you will develop the skills to complete a project plan that ensures completion on time, to budget and within the project specifications. In doing so, you will understand:
• Phases of a project
• Communication techniques
• Roles and responsibilities of the project manager
• Planning and control in project management
• Project management tools and techniques.
